1

起動タスクを実行するセルフホストのwcfサービスがあります

netsh http add urlacl url=https://+:{PORT}/{SERVICENAME} user=everyone listen=yes delegate=yes"

以前はサービスにsslがありませんでしたが、古いhttp url予約はまだそこにありました(または私が知らない他の何かによって追加されました)。

では、起動タスクにnetsh removeを追加する必要がありますか?

編集:予約がそこにあるかどうかを確認するために、役割にデスクトップ版を削除します。

4

2 に答える 2

1

シナリオをよりよく理解するために、アプリケーションをクラウドにデプロイするときは、仮想化環境内の仮想マシンでアプリケーションを実行しています。アプリケーションはデータセンター内で実行されますが、仮想マシンはホストマシンでホストされ、特定の理由でいつでも変更できます。これは、ゲストOSまたはホストOSの更新、ハードウェア障害、リソース変更要件、およびその他の理由により発生する可能性があります。そのため、仮想マシンが常に同じであると考えるべきではありません。具体的には、仮想マシンは「仮想」です。

于 2012-09-05T18:28:10.530 に答える
0

同じになるとは決して思いませんが、ハードウェアに障害が発生し、他の場所のデータセンター内で役割が再開された場合、それは確かにそうではありません。起動タスクはべき等である必要があります。

于 2012-09-05T17:40:37.427 に答える